tI have been running XP on my laptop for some time. It was installed as an
upgrade from w98. The w98 disk has been lost, and my system has crashed. I
have a back up but it is on separate storage, and I cannot access it. I have
attempted to reinstall XP on the new drive but since the disk has never had
an operating system on it the upgrade disk will not install without the W98
disk. Is there a way to install it on the new disk?
 
G

Guest

If you have the 'Upgrade Edition' of XP Pro you will need to have the
installation CD of any previous version of Windows.

It can be inserted during the installation, when prompted.

If you've lost your copy of the 98 CD or Me CD: see if a neighbour or friend
can assist.
